n an advertisement that is written and presented in the style of an editorial or journalistic report
2
plural of advertorial n an advertisement that is written and presented in the style of an editorial or journalistic report
3
read, write, or edit a shared on-line journal
4
n a shared on-line journal where people can post diary entries about their personal experiences and hobbies v read, write, or edit a shared on-line journal